There are no true antelope in North America. The Pronghorn is often referred to as the Pronghorn antelope but the

Pronghorn is actually the only member of it's taxonomic family of Antelocapridae. The antelope are members of the family Bovidae.

Arizona, Colorado, Montana, Idaho, Wyoming, Utah...et cetera have populations

of pronghorns that are often referred to as antelope. There are no true antelope in North American. Pronghorns are the only member of Antelocapridae.
